Определения

geriatricсуществительное
An elderly person, especially one who is receiving specialist medical care.
The community center organizes daily activities for the geriatrics living nearby.
geriatricприлагательное
Relating to old age or elderly people.
The geriatric patients at the hospital require specialized care.
Pertaining to the medical care or treatment of older adults.
She is a geriatric nurse, focusing on the health needs of the elderly.
